Cheyenne, WY Real Estate

Cheyenne is the capital and the most populous city of the U.S. state of Wyoming, and the county seat of Laramie County. It is the principal city of the 'Cheyenne, Wyoming Metropolitan Statistical Area ' which encompasses all of Laramie County, Wyoming. As of September 2005, it had an estimated population of 55,362.

On July 4, 1867, General Grenville M. Dodge, the Union Pacific Railroad 's superintendent of construction, along with railroad representatives, surveyors, land agents, military officers, and some of Dodge ™s personal friends arrived at an area known as Crow Creek Crossing. About 250 soldiers accompanied them to the Crossing in southeastern Dakota Territory to a rendezvous with General Christopher Columbus Augur, his 350 troops, and Pawnee Scouts. Dodge had planned the founding of his new city specifically on the nation's birthday.

During his two weeks at Crow Creek Crossing, Dodge with his survey crew platted the site two miles by two miles, now known as Cheyenne (Dakota Territory, later Wyoming Territory). He knew, from having been in the area before as a commander of troops looking for unruly Indians, he wanted Crow Creek Crossing as the Division Point for the U. P. railroad. It was the exact location, where to the east, land went down hill gradually five hundred miles to the railroad's head at Council Bluffs, Iowa and in the opposite direction began the railroad's most serious climb. Sherman Hill, named after one of Dodge's Civil War commanding officers, would rise more than two thousand, two hundred feet in just thirty miles to the west of Cheyenne.
